- The Rams are currently riding a 21-match home winning streak. That marks the fourth-longest current home winning streak of any team in the country that has played at least two seasons at the NCAA Division I level. Only No. 2 Nebraska (78 straight home wins), No. 1 Penn State (43) and No. 5 Southern California (28) have a longer streak than CSU. The longest home winning streak in school history was 44 straight matches from Sept. 18, 1998-Nov. 18, 2000.
- CSU currently leads the nation in blocking at 3.21 per set.
- The Rams and Cowgirls will be meeting for the 63rd time. CSU has won 20 consecutive matches against Wyoming.
- CSU ranks eighth in the country in attendance at 2,697 fans per match.
- On Monday, senior Mekana Barnes was named the MWC Co-Player of the Week. It marked her fifth career weekly award. Angela Knopf (1997-2001) holds the school record with six Player of the Week awards.
